@ -0,0 +1,86 @@
|
|||
from dataclasses import dataclass
|
||||
from functools import lru_cache
|
||||
|
||||
import tilelang
|
||||
import tilelang.language as T
|
||||
import torch
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def _tl_dtype(dtype: torch.dtype):
|
||||
if dtype is torch.float16:
|
||||
return T.float16
|
||||
if dtype is torch.float32:
|
||||
return T.float32
|
||||
raise TypeError(f"unsupported TileLang dtype: {dtype}")
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@tilelang.jit
|
||||
def _copy_eager_kernel(src, BLOCK_N: int, dtype):
|
||||
N = T.const("N")
|
||||
src: T.Tensor((N,), dtype)
|
||||
out = T.empty((N,), dtype)
|
||||
|
||||
with T.Kernel(N // BLOCK_N, threads=256) as pid_n:
|
||||
T.copy(
|
||||
src[pid_n * BLOCK_N : (pid_n + 1) * BLOCK_N],
|
||||
out[pid_n * BLOCK_N : (pid_n + 1) * BLOCK_N],
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
return out
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def _block_n(n: int) -> int:
|
||||
return 1024 if n % 1024 == 0 else n
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@lru_cache(maxsize=32)
|
||||
def _compiled_copy_eager(n: int, block_n: int, dtype: torch.dtype):
|
||||
return _copy_eager_kernel.compile(N=n, BLOCK_N=block_n, dtype=_tl_dtype(dtype))
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@dataclass
|
||||
class EagerCopyPrepared:
|
||||
out: torch.Tensor
|
||||
src: torch.Tensor
|
||||
kernel: object
|
||||
|
||||
def run(self) -> None:
|
||||
self.out.copy_(self.kernel(self.src))
|
||||
|
||||
def destroy(self) -> None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def __enter__(self):
|
||||
return self
|
||||
|
||||
def __exit__(self, exc_type, exc, tb) -> None:
|
||||
self.destroy()
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def prepare_copy_eager(out: torch.Tensor, src: torch.Tensor) -> EagerCopyPrepared:
|
||||
if out.shape != src.shape:
|
||||
raise ValueError("eager copy expects matching shapes")
|
||||
if out.dtype != src.dtype:
|
||||
raise TypeError("eager copy expects matching dtypes")
|
||||
if not out.is_cuda or not src.is_cuda:
|
||||
raise ValueError("eager copy expects CUDA tensors")
|
||||
if not out.is_contiguous() or not src.is_contiguous():
|
||||
raise ValueError("eager copy v1 supports contiguous tensors only")
|
||||
|
||||
n = src.numel()
|
||||
block_n = _block_n(n)
|
||||
if n % block_n != 0:
|
||||
raise ValueError("eager copy v1 requires N % BLOCK_N == 0")
|
||||
kernel = _compiled_copy_eager(n, block_n, src.dtype)
|
||||
return EagerCopyPrepared(out, src, kernel)
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def copy_eager_(out: torch.Tensor, src: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
|
||||
with prepare_copy_eager(out, src) as prepared:
|
||||
prepared.run()
|
||||
return out
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def copy_eager(src: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
|
||||
out = torch.empty_like(src)
|
||||
return copy_eager_(out, src)

@ -0,0 +1,91 @@
|
|||
from dataclasses import dataclass
|
||||
from functools import lru_cache
|
||||
|
||||
import tilelang
|
||||
import tilelang.language as T
|
||||
import torch
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def _tl_dtype_str(dtype: torch.dtype) -> str:
|
||||
if dtype is torch.float16:
|
||||
return "float16"
|
||||
if dtype is torch.float32:
|
||||
return "float32"
|
||||
raise TypeError(f"unsupported TileLang dtype: {dtype}")
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@tilelang.jit(out_idx=[1])
|
||||
def _copy_lazy_out_idx_kernel(n: int, block_n: int, dtype: str):
|
||||
@T.prim_func
|
||||
def main(src: T.Tensor((n,), dtype), out: T.Tensor((n,), dtype)):
|
||||
with T.Kernel(n // block_n, threads=256) as pid_n:
|
||||
T.copy(
|
||||
src[pid_n * block_n : (pid_n + 1) * block_n],
|
||||
out[pid_n * block_n : (pid_n + 1) * block_n],
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
return main
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def _block_n(n: int) -> int:
|
||||
return 1024 if n % 1024 == 0 else n
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@lru_cache(maxsize=32)
|
||||
def _compiled_copy_lazy_out_idx(n: int, block_n: int, dtype: torch.dtype):
|
||||
return _copy_lazy_out_idx_kernel(n, block_n, _tl_dtype_str(dtype))
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@dataclass
|
||||
class LazyOutIdxCopyPrepared:
|
||||
out: torch.Tensor
|
||||
src: torch.Tensor
|
||||
kernel: object
|
||||
|
||||
def run(self) -> None:
|
||||
# out_idx makes TileLang allocate and return the output tensor. The
|
||||
# training runtime keeps an out-variant API, so this adapter copies the
|
||||
# result into the caller-owned output buffer.
|
||||
self.out.copy_(self.kernel(self.src))
|
||||
|
||||
def destroy(self) -> None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def __enter__(self):
|
||||
return self
|
||||
|
||||
def __exit__(self, exc_type, exc, tb) -> None:
|
||||
self.destroy()
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def prepare_copy_lazy_out_idx(out: torch.Tensor, src: torch.Tensor) -> LazyOutIdxCopyPrepared:
|
||||
if out.shape != src.shape:
|
||||
raise ValueError("lazy out_idx copy expects matching shapes")
|
||||
if out.dtype != src.dtype:
|
||||
raise TypeError("lazy out_idx copy expects matching dtypes")
|
||||
if not out.is_cuda or not src.is_cuda:
|
||||
raise ValueError("lazy out_idx copy expects CUDA tensors")
|
||||
if not out.is_contiguous() or not src.is_contiguous():
|
||||
raise ValueError("lazy out_idx copy v1 supports contiguous tensors only")
|
||||
|
||||
n = src.numel()
|
||||
block_n = _block_n(n)
|
||||
if n % block_n != 0:
|
||||
raise ValueError("lazy out_idx copy v1 requires N % BLOCK_N == 0")
|
||||
kernel = _compiled_copy_lazy_out_idx(n, block_n, src.dtype)
|
||||
return LazyOutIdxCopyPrepared(out, src, kernel)
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def copy_lazy_out_idx_(out: torch.Tensor, src: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
|
||||
with prepare_copy_lazy_out_idx(out, src) as prepared:
|
||||
prepared.run()
|
||||
return out
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def copy_lazy_out_idx(src: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or:
|
||||
n = src.numel()
|
||||
block_n = _block_n(n)
|
||||
if n % block_n != 0:
|
||||
raise ValueError("lazy out_idx copy v1 requires N % BLOCK_N == 0")
|
||||
kernel = _compiled_copy_lazy_out_idx(n, block_n, src.dtype)
|
||||
return kernel(src)
